Looking at slip-ons for the power-tune duals I am putting on my 03 serk. How do the different baffle sizes affect bottom end torque ?

 a smaller baffle will deliver more low-end… larger more noise # big end power … play it safe 2 inch baffle, im running 1.75 and very content with low end trq.

baffle size applies to any muffler,  except stock.... and if your working with 2 into 1....  D&D, Rush, Dragos, ect.  youll want to run a 2.5 inch baffle . your results may vary but I doubt it
